The world of tailor-made solutions from the SLS modular system begins with the ZSL/ZSLq freight elevator! The ZSL is a freight elevator with 2 lifting columns, on which a hoisting cage, a platform or a user-specific device (support frame, lifting frame) is raised.

  • Basically we differentiate 2 Varianten depending on the arrangement of the lifting columns:

    ZSL (two-column lift) as a freight elevator with a front basket

    The ZSL is ideal when it comes to the one-sided, space-saving arrangement of the lifting columns.

    The ZSL is a freight elevator with two lifting columns, on which a hoisting cage, a platform or a user-specific device (support frame, lifting frame) is raised. The lifting columns are arranged in pairs on one side of the hoisting cage. The ZSL has a payload of up to 1500 kg and can be designed for lifting heights of up to 12 m.

    There is a large variety of hoisting baskets with a projection of up to 1700 mm and a length of 4000 mm. Normally, these are "raised floor baskets" in which the cage platform consists of an approximately 90 mm high, torsion-resistant support frame. As with all of our column lifts, the cage is fully fenced. The cage enclosure has a standard height of 1100 mm and consists of stable welded mesh. Basket access doors can be fitted on up to 3 sides and are arranged according to the customer's requirements. Of course, they are secured with limit switches and integrated into the lift control. Larger basket enclosures are also possible in a variety of ways, even a complete conveyor cage.

    ZSLq (two-column lift "transverse") arranged as a freight elevator with a hoisting basket between the lifting columns

    The ZSLQ is the preferred variant for installation situations in which only very limited horizontal forces can be introduced into the building structure.

    The ZSLQ is a goods lift with two lifting columns, between which a cage, a platform or a user-specific device (support frame, lifting frame) is raised. The pair of lifting columns is arranged in such a way that the hoisting cage slides up between the two. The ZSLQ also has a payload of up to 1500 kg and can be designed for lifting heights of up to 12 m.

    There is a wide variety of conveyor cages adapted to customer requirements. As a rule, these are "raised floor baskets" in which the platform of the hoisting cage consists of an approximately 90 mm high, torsion-resistant support frame. As with all of our column lifts, the cage is fully fenced. The cage enclosure has a standard height of 1100 mm and consists of stable welded mesh. Basket access doors can be fitted at the front and rear and are positioned according to the customer's requirements.

    By default, the ZSL/ZSLq is designed as a fully enclosed, self-running lift system. Each floor has appropriate landing doors and all required fixed enclosures of machine guards. The storey doors are system-integrated and can only be opened when the hoisting cage is in front of it, thanks to an electric safety lock.

     

  • Manufactured in accordance with Machinery Directive 2006/42/EG and DIN EN 81/31 for accessible goods lifts including all storey access doors and necessary enclosures made of machine guards.

     

    • safety gear
    • Duplex chain drive with 4x safety factor
    • Electromechanical engine brake
    • chain tension sensor
    • electrically locked landing doors
    • active overload protection
    • upper emergency limit switch;
    • thermal motor protection;

  • Basic technical information

    feature Value unity
    Load capacity max. 1500 kg
    Lifting height to 12.000 mm
    Lifting / lowering speed (standard) standard 4,2 (optional up to 16,8) m / min.
    Control Automatic control with control points on all floors  
    Minimum conveyor cage length (external dimension) 1000 mm
    Maximum conveyor cage length (external dimension) 4000 mm
    Minimum conveyor cage width (external dimension) 1000 mm
    Maximum conveyor cage width (external dimension) 3000 mm
    Enclosure height conveyor cage 1100 – 2000 mm
    Horsepower 4,0 kW
    Control voltage 24 V
    Protection IP 54 to IP 66  
    Connection values 400V (3PH+N+PE/50Hz)  
    Start-up mode Soft start / soft stop  
    Motor data S1 motor (continuously running)  
    Conveyor cage / means Customizable in 100mm increments
